knoppix is safer?
If I use the net via Knoppix on a dual boot win98 and Fedora Core system can I get invaded by a Buffer overflow attack? Or does the no write aspect of Knoppix protect me?
Telzey |
Knoppix loads applications into RAM just like a hard disk based distro. Anything that corrupts memory is still a risk. The difference is that changes can't be written out to disk to happen again after a re-boot.
